In my essay I would like to discuss how media 'shape' us.
I would like to research on below mentioned subjects and discuss how media teach us how "to see and to be".
- The role of 'the gaze'
- Seeing and perception
- Cosmetic surgeries

Bibliography (so far):

- Balsamo, A. (1992) 'On The Cutting Edge: Cosmetic Surgery and The Technological Production of the Gendered Body', camera obscura 22
- Berger, J. (1972). Ways of Seeing. London, Penguin Books
- Frith, K., Shaw, P., Cheng, H. (2005). 'The Construction of Beauty: A Cross-Cultural Analysis of Women's Magazine Advertising.' in Journal of Communication
- Haraway, D. (1991) 'The Persistence of Vision' in Simians, Cyborgs and Women: The Reinvention of Nature
- Sturken, M., Cartwright, L. (2001) 'Spectatorship, Power and Knowledge' in Practices of Looking: An Introduction To Visual Culture
